Milwaukee-Eight Reliability

The Milwaukee-Eight 107 engine (2018+) significantly improved reliability over older Twin Cam motors, running cooler and requiring less frequent service intervals of 5,000 miles. Most owners report minimal issues past 50,000 miles with proper maintenance.

⚠️

Watch for Heat Issues

Rear cylinder heat buildup in stop-and-go traffic is a known complaint — check for heat shields and consider an aftermarket stage 1 tune. Early 2018-2019 models had some compensator sprocket noise worth inspecting before purchase.

💰

Strong Resale Value

The Street Bob consistently holds 70-80% of its original value after two years, outperforming many competitors in its class. Its stripped-down bobber styling has broad appeal, making it one of Harley's easier models to resell quickly.

年別の世代と仕様

2006–2017 Gen 1

ツインカム96/103エンジン、ミニマリストボバースタイル、ワイドハンドルバーを備えたオリジナルのDyna-Platformストリートボブ。

expand_more
8.1/10

"無駄を削ぎ落としたダイナが、実際にその姿勢を勝ち取っているのだ。"

Twin Cam 103は2,000rpmから強く引っ張り、Vツインが求めるサウンドとまったく同じです。その傾斜した不均一なアイドル状態は、2年間使用しても古くなることはありません。Dynaのシャーシは、Softailsでは実現できないソフトな機能を実現しています。実際のコーナリングクリアランスと、駐車場で見栄えが良いだけでなく、スイーパーを通して正直に追従するフレームです。とはいえ、302 kgはキャンバーのサイドスタンドから筋肉を張るたびに感じる本物の数値であり、ストックシートは約90分後にテールボーンをクレーム部門に変えます。ハイウェイクルーズのペグとバーを通る振動は、時代に合わせたハーレーのものです。最初は魅力的で、4時間のランニングでは疲れ果ててしまいます。

The Street Bob is Harley's stripped-back bruiser — no frills, no apologies. It's the bike you buy when you want the Milwaukee iron experience without paying for a bunch of chrome you'll never polish. The 114ci Milwaukee-Eight in post-2018 models is genuinely strong, pulling hard from low revs with that characteristic potato-potato lope that still makes grown men emotional. Handling is better than the fat-tire crowd will admit, though don't expect canyon carving — this thing wants to cruise, not chase sportbikes. On used examples, check the primary chain tensioner and watch for leaky pushrod tubes on anything pre-2017. The softail frame used from 2018 onward transformed the ride quality dramatically, so I'd steer hard toward that generation if budget allows. Electronics are basic, which is actually a blessing — less to go wrong. Previous owners love bolting stuff on, so you'll often find exhaust upgrades and handlebars already done, which cuts your modification budget nicely.

よくある問題

🔥 1 CRITICAL
⚠️Primary chain tensioner wear and noise MODERATE

Listen for rattling at idle, cold start especially

Fix cost: $200-$500
💡Heat soak and vapor lock issues MINOR

Test restart after 20-minute hot soak period

Fix cost: $50-$200
🔥Compensator sprocket failure and clunking SERIOUS

Clunk when engaging first gear, check service history

Fix cost: $400-$900
💡Fork seal leaks on front suspension MINOR

Oil residue on fork tubes below seals

Fix cost: $150-$350

Full Specifications

Engine Power 93 hp @ 5,020 rpm (2018+ Milwaukee-Eight 107)
Torque 145 Nm @ 3,000 rpm (2018+ Milwaukee-Eight 107)
Top Speed 185 km/h (estimated; note: electronically limited in some markets)
Weight 291 kg (wet/curb weight — 2021 model)
Fuel Consumption 5.5 L/100km (approximately 18 km/L) — estimated real-world average
Type Cruiser
Fairing No Fairing (Naked)
